## Escalation — Trailglass Audit-Log Viewer

If the Trailglass viewer shows gaps in the audit stream, first confirm whether ingestion or rendering is at fault by querying the raw store directly. Rendering-only gaps are severity-3; missing raw records are severity-1 and must be escalated within fifteen minutes, as they may indicate tampering. Preserve the query window, export the surrounding records, and do not restart the ingestion workers before capture. Escalations for severity-1 events go to the address below.

escalation mailbox, hadug-bajog: sormir@norvalabs.internal

## TICKET: Config drift on GateCount prod nodes — Arenaworks Stadium

The turnstile counter service on the east-concourse nodes is reporting different debounce and aggregation settings than what's in the release manifest. Looks like a hotfix in March was applied by hand and never backported. Counts from gates 12–18 are running roughly 3% high as a result. Requesting sign-off to re-baseline all nodes to the manifest values, reproduced here for review.

deployment values, fahap-hahaf:
[casdor]
port = 9200
region = south-2
host = casdor.qirvanworks.corp
timeout_ms = 3000
retries = 4

Donation-receipt mailer (GiveTrail). If a donor reports a missing receipt, first confirm the gift shows as settled in the Ledgerette console. If settled but unmailed, requeue via the Resend action — do not re-create the donation. Duplicate receipts confuse year-end tax summaries. Requeues batch every 15 minutes; tell the donor to allow one hour. Escalate stuck batches to the Stewardship rota. Full procedure and edge cases are documented on the internal page below.

runbook for badug-kadup: https://confluence.zemvarlabs.internal/projects/browse/display/projects/bd1b

Subject: Marketing budget — heads up

Team, quick note before Friday's sync: we're trimming marketing spend by 15% for the rest of the year, mostly from the Brightmoor campaign and event sponsorships. Digital stays intact. Jonas has already rebalanced the media plan, so no fire drill needed. Happy to walk the new director through details. The reasoning sits just below.

management briefing: Project Ulavan slips by two quarters because of the staffing delay.